The Critical Role of Licensing in Online Casinos

Aspect Significance
Regulatory Compliance Ensures operators adhere to legal standards, protecting player rights and reducing fraud.
Fairness and Randomness Licenses often require testing agencies like eCOGRA or iTech to verify game integrity, giving players confidence in game outcomes.
Player Security Licensed platforms implement robust data protection measures, ensuring secure transactions and personal information handling.
Dispute Resolution Regulated operators often participate in independent adjudication processes, offering players avenues for fair dispute resolution.

Industry Benchmarks and Licensing Authorities

The global online gambling landscape is governed by numerous licensing jurisdictions, each with varying levels of stringency and enforcement. Prominent authorities include:

  • UK Gambling Commission: Known for rigorous standards and player protection policies.
  • Malta Gaming Authority: A respected jurisdiction with a comprehensive licensing framework that supports responsible gambling.
  • Gibraltar Regulatory Authority: Provides licenses with high compliance standards, often preferred by premium operators.

Operators licensed by these authorities are subject to regular audits, and their licenses confer a mark of credibility that’s recognized universally within the industry.

For example, a premium online casino that obtains a license from the UK Gambling Commission demonstrates adherence to strict fairness and security standards, often exceeding the legal minimums.
